WebNov 18, 2024 · What do fresh water dragon fish eat? The fish is omnivorous and thrives on a high-protein diet in captivity. Feed your pet dragon fish algae wafers, live brine shrimp, mysis shrimp and daphnia. Dragon fish will also consume frozen bloodworms, krill and glassworms. In addition, you can feed your pet fish pellets and vegetable flakes. WebAustralian water dragons are diurnal, so they need day and night cycles. When your light source is off, you need to maintain temperatures no lower than 80 degrees F. You may need a heat emitter to ensure your pet is warm at night. Humidity. Australian water dragons thrive in environments of at least 70% humidity all the time.

Goitrogenic foods are foods that bind iodine and disturb its absorption in the organism. Over time, feeding too many of those foods can lead to thyroid issues. Example of goitrogenic foods that you should limit are: 1. Radishes 2. Rapini 3. Rutabaga (swede) 4. Turnips 5. Kohlrabi 6.
